Zantedeschia aethiopica White Giant/Hercules (Arum Lily, Calla Lily)

Introducing the Zantedeschia aethiopica White Giant/Hercules, also known as the Giant Arum Lily or Calla Lily. This unique variety is often confused with Zantedeschia Hercules, but our White Giant has distinct white spots on its leaves and is the largest of its kind. It is not widely available in the UK, making it a rare and special addition to any garden.

Native to South Africa, this perennial can reach a staggering height of 6ft in a single season when given the right conditions – plenty of feed, warmth, and moisture. Our nursery in Somerset, South West United Kingdom, has propagated these plants to ensure their quality and availability.

While hardy, this Zantedeschia may experience frost damage to its leaves during winter. Simply trim back the foliage after the last frosts and new shoots will emerge from the ground. For optimal growth and flowering, plant in a sheltered spot with loamy soil and protect during cold periods.

  • Height:Easily maintained to1.5m,Flowering Stems up to 2m
  • Spread:Easily maintained to1m
  • Foliage Colour:Green withwhite spots, large leaves
  • Flower Colour:Whitebuds and white funnel shaped flowers
  • Soil Type:Moist,boggy, loam, chalk, thrives in moist conditions
  • Position:Semi Shade – Shade
  • Hardiness:ReasonablyHardy once established, H4 (-5 to -10), cold conditions may damage leaves but the plant will re shootfrom the base
  • Type:Evergreen

The hardy forms ofZantedeschiaare varieties that derive from the speciesZantedeschia aethiopicaandZantedeschia pentlandii, these are mainly white flowered varieties sometimes having coloured throats likeZantedeschia aethiopica Kiwi Blush.Zantedeschia pentlandiiis striking in having bright yellow flowers.

All the Zantedeschia we grow here are the hardy forms. To ensure these plants thrive in your garden it is best to plant them in moist soil in semi-shade, bright sun can slow their growth and scorch the leaves. Also in mild winters these perennials can be evergreen and put on growth through winter, in this scenario a sharp frost will kill these fresh shoots of the top growth but will not harm the plant, it will just re-shoot from the root in spring. A good mulch over winter greatly helps the plant too by insulating the shoots just below the soil from frost and ensuring a good strong root base from which masses of shoots will appear in the spring.

These plants can also be grown in containers and for this they will respond best to a loam based compost, they don`t want to be planted too deep and respond well to regular feeding. When grown in pots the plants should be protected over winter as the root is above the ground (in the pot) and can be damaged by frost. The containers should be watered regularly and the compost should be kept moist at all times. These plants grow well in the UK, we have them here on our nursery in the South West of England but with a bit of protection (fleece in extreme conditions, mulch or moving containers into a greenhouse) they can be grown all over the UK.
